Este MOC, foi feito com o objectivo de apresentar como projecto final do meu curso (Já devem estar fartos de ler isto).
Descrição geral:AUTrolls é um portão que abre e fecha na vertical por meio de guias, dividindo em secções, construído também com as peças da linha Lego Technic e Mindstorms (tijolos vazados, eixos, engrenagens, correntes e motor ).

O servomotor, controlado pelo NXT, funciona como sensor de rotação. O NXT através do software Lego Mindstorms NXT consegue saber qual a posição do motor, medida em graus.
Por meio das engrenagens, o motor gira as correntes de forma a puxar o portão, abrindo ou fechando, dependendo do sentido de rotação. O motor como sensor de rotação, quando o portão estiver a abrir ou a fechar vai saber se chegou ao fim (totalmente aberto ou totalmente fechado), ou seja quando sentir força envia a informação, que não está a andar, para o NXT e este por sua vez envia a ordem para parar.

Este portão, não contém sensores para além do servomotor, por isso, o sistema de segurança funciona de uma forma diferente. O próprio portão detecta os obstáculos, por meio do motor. Quando o portão estiver a fechar, se o motor sentir a força antes de, mais ou menos, cinco/seis segundos (aproximadamente o tempo que leva o portão a fechar) o NXT dá a ordem de parar e passar a abrir, caso passe esses segundos o portão pára e fica fechado até receber a ordem para abrir.
De acordo com a posição do portão o display vai dando a informação do seu estado: aberto, fechado, a abrir ou a fechar. Para além destes, informa também se detectou obstáculo.

O portão fecha automaticamente quando passe cinco minutos sem receber a ordem para fechar. Depois disso, volta tudo ao início.